TRIPOLI, November 25 (Mercy for Mankind) – The
seventh general conference of the World Islamic Call Society has
grabbed attention by media outlets, especially on the international
information network known as the Internet, reflecting the huge
importance of the conference entitled "we have not sent you forth
but a mercy for mankind". The conference's slogan "Mercy for mankind" was largely covered by
Libyan dailies that highlighted preparations and receiving of guests
that started converging on Tripoli en masse days before it was to
take off Friday, November 26. About 500 figures representing some 400 Islamic organizations,
institutions and Sufi sects from some 128 countries are taking part
in the conference, to last till Monday, November 29. The weekly Islamic Call Journal covered the news of the conference
on its front page in its latest editions. On the internet, IslamOnline.net paid a special attention to the
conference on its Arabic and English Web Sites, where an article
entitled "Mercy for Mankind" in WICS Conference" was posted on its
news page in English and Arabic. The article said that this year's slogan "Mercy for Mankind" tackles
two major issues. First is the concept of mercy in Islam to address
accusations labeled against Islam of violence and condoning terror. "The second is the universality of Islam's message." It also quoted Dr. Mohamed El-Sharief, WICS Secretary-General, as
saying that discussions and deliberations were held to decide on the
conference's slogan and agenda, bearing in mind the current
circumstances taking place in the world and directly affecting the
Muslim world. "The slogan (Mercy for Mankind) is consistent with our intellectual
and religious beliefs in the WICS. The Noble Qur'an and Prophetic
tradition are our only basics, from which we move forward and tackle
all issues. We wanted that message to be clear by picking a Qur'anic
term as a slogan for the conference," he told IslamOnline.net. On his part, Chief Editor of IOL Arabic Site, Mr. Hisham Gaafar
